Freeze first and last rows
How can I freeze the header row and the summation row of an Excel data sheet
so I can scroll only the data between them? I can't combine freeze row and split row to do this, apparently. Thanks. |
Freeze first and last rows
You can put your summaries on the top row - insert a new row 1, then
